The Pediatric Mental Health Specialist position provides the opportunity to grow your career in the mental and behavioral health field by learning de-escalation skills and techniques, gaining an understanding of behaviors, building rapport, and problem solving. PMHSs are coaches for our patients. PMHSs work directly with patients and help lead them through a series of scheduled activities, including skills groups. These groups promote healthy problem-solving, social, and coping skills that are developmentally appropriate for each age group. PMHSs work with complex and acute psychiatric patients in a fast-paced environment, implementing interventions that promote a safe and therapeutic setting for patients, families, and staff. The PBMU is an inpatient crisis stabilization unit where we treat children ages 3–17 who are in psychiatric crisis. Our 41-bed unit is split into three programs: Child, Adolescent, and the Biobehavioral Inpatient Program.
